Growing concerns pertaining to depletion of non-renewable resources coupled with high manufacturing cost of primary metals has augmented the demand for metal recycling. Emergence of modern technologies have proved to be quite effective in terms of identifying different kinds of metals, especially ferrous.
Growing demand for scrap has compelled scrap yards to install technologically advanced and sophisticated recycling equipment. For instance, large recycling facilities these days have installed sensors to identify metals through infra-red scanning and x-ray. Considering the benefits of recycling, manufacturers are opting for secondary metal production processes for cost effective and environmental-friendly manufacturing.
Steel is the largest product segment of the metal recycling market. Steel can be manufactured through two processes, basic oxygen furnace and electric arc furnace. Steel manufactured in an electric arc furnace uses scrap as its key raw material. Growing benefits of metal recycling has augmented the production of steel through electric arc furnace.
